What are the Possible Causes of the DTC P1825 Cadillac?

NOTE: The causes shown may not be a complete list of all potential problems, and it is possible that there may be other causes.
  • Faulty Internal Mode Switch
  • Internal Mode Switch harness is open or shorted
  • Internal Mode Switch circuit poor electrical connection

What is the Cost to Diagnose the Code?

Labor: 1.0

To diagnose the P1825 Cadillac code, it typically requires 1.0 hour of labor. The specific diagnosis time and labor rates at auto repair shops can differ based on factors such as the location, make and model of the vehicle, and even the engine type. It is common for most auto repair shops to charge between $75 and $150 per hour.

Code P1825 Cadillac Description

The manual shift detent lever with shaft position switch assembly, or Internal Mode Switch (IMS) assembly is a sliding contact switch attached to the control valve body within the transmission. The 4 inputs to the Transmission Control Module (TCM) from the switch indicate which position is selected by the transmission manual shaft. The input voltage at the TCM is high when the switch is open and low when the switch is closed to ground. The state of each input is displayed on the scan tool as IMS.
